would I benefit at all from changing my gear ratio? I have the stock 3.73? ratio on my lifted 2000 suburban 5.3L with 33's. If so, where does one buy this or have it done?

Um, of course you would gain some quickness but you would only go up to 4.10, IMO it really isn't worth changing from 3.73 to 4.10 just for a set of 33's, if you know for sure that you will be going up to 35's then i'd say get some 4.56's now and even with 33's your milage wouldnt be all that bad in comparison but you would be quicker than the average burb.

As for getting them done...it depends where you live. If you are located in a city im sure there is a shop that specializes in gears and drive train.
